 <description>&lt;p&gt;Nanowrimo 2009 Entry: Surviving Manila: Risen Threat&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;There were hundreds upon thousands of them, moving down the narrowing section of the Epifanio de los Santos Avenue as if in silent protest against the corrupt regime of a debilitated government. No banners were raised in this march of the masses this time however. No music-interwoven insults were chanted. No stage was raised at the foot of the massive metal madonna whose outstretched hands held immobile beams of concrete hope.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This was no revolution unfolding upon the main road known as EDSA.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;It was well past the third hour of the afternoon and the sun hung closer towards the horizon. A comfortably chilly November such as this would typically be punctuated by the blare of car horns, the groan and rumble of privately-owned buses and the self-serving sirens of the escorted public officials whose cars (regardless of whom rode in them) were given priority and enforced passage through the traffic slowed streets. Instead, there was an ominous lingering silence. The uneasy peace of quiet blanketed the area was reminiscent of ghost towns and movie cities that had been ravaged by the hordes of the undead or the undiscriminating touch of plague.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;And that was quite an apt comparison.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;For indeed Manila was infected with plague.&lt;br /&gt;
A plague of the hungry and the walking dead.&lt;/p&gt;

 <description>&lt;p&gt;I got a 51237 word count, submitted a scrambled version of the novel and won! Anyways this is a short chronicle of what happened during the four weeks of literary abandon.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;First week: I did not feel slowing down! My story actually has some nice descriptions in it and good character development.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Second week: Still not slowing down but the &quot;writing juice&quot; is running out. I started doing 1667 words per day. Plot twists are developing for some reason.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Third week: The chore of writing has become unbearable, only a few hints of inspirations here and there. However, the characters seems to be hell bent on reaching their intended goals, with or without grammar.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Final week: Somehow got a second wind and did a writing frenzy. I managed to make the characters to their goals during 45,000 mark and did some 6000 words worth of epilogue material.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Most hated day: Saturday since I would do double duty and do 3k words so that I would be free on Sundays&lt;br /&gt;
